Article clipped from Salt Lake City Mining Review

Besides the tunnels mentioned, the properties of the Sevier Consolidated have beenfurther prospected by means of shafts, opencuts, winzes, etc., along the strike of theveins a distance of 2,000 feet. The minesare easily accessible to the Rio GrandeiWestern railroad. Sevier station is the4r-nearest point on that road, being twelve miles distant. The wagon road to Sevier is good and is down hill all the way from the mine.
